[ QUOTE ]
I might be able to live with Oly Gold /Black int. The other thing I forgot to mention, its a t 400 on the column and I'm thinking doing a 4 or 5 speed. Any thoughts on that? Thank you, [/ QUOTE ]Mike, If you want to do all these changes to an original BB camaro just go get a nice 6 cylinder/307 car and do these changes. Gold with DG interior is great color combo. I would not change an original BB cars colors, I would get another car to do or sell the one you have for a different color combo. In the old days that color combo would not be real popular with people. But orange, plum crazy and some of the Yenko Deuce colors were NOT real popular around here either. Look at BBBenny's silver COPO/blue interior I love that combo because of the lite blue interior. In 69 most people would have orderd a black or red interior with silver but not the guy who owned that car originally. Ask John Karvonen if he would have changed the color of his brown 69 Z's interior from DG to black again. His car is an extremely nice and well restored 69 Z. JMO ![]() |
